java中cell.getCellType()
时间: 2024-04-15 07:24:44 浏览: 11
在Java中,`cell.getCellType()`是用于获取单元格的数据类型的方法。它返回一个整数值,表示单元格的数据类型。常见的数据类型包括:
- `CellType.NUMERIC`:数字类型
- `CellType.STRING`:字符串类型
- `CellType.BOOLEAN`:布尔类型
- `CellType.FORMULA`:公式类型
- `CellType.BLANK`:空白类型
- `CellType.ERROR`:错误类型
你可以使用这个方法来判断单元格的数据类型,然后根据需要进行相应的处理。
相关问题
java.lang.NoSuchMethodError: org.apache.poi.ss.usermodel.Cell.getCellType()
这个错误通常是由于使用了不兼容的 Apache POI 版本所导致的。可能是您的代码中使用的 Apache POI 版本与您的项目中其他库所依赖的版本不兼容。
解决方案是,检查您的项目中使用的 Apache POI 版本和其他库所依赖的版本是否一致。如果不一致,尝试升级您的 Apache POI 版本或者与其他库所依赖的版本保持一致。
Handler dispatch failed; nested exception is java.lang.NoSuchMethodError: org.apache.poi.ss.usermodel.Cell.getCellType()I
这个错误是由于在使用Apache POI库时,调用一个不存在的方法导致的。具体来说,错误信息中提到的方法是getCellType(),它在新版本的POI库中已经被废弃或者移除了。
要解决这个问题,你可以尝试以下几个步骤:
1. 检查你使用的POI库的版本是否正确。确保你使用的是最新版本的POI库,并且与你的代码兼容。
2. 检查你的代码中是否有其他地方调用了已经被废弃或者移除的方法。如果有,需要修改代码以适应新版本的POI库。
3. 如果你使用的是Maven或Gradle等构建工具,可以尝试清理和重新构建项目,以确保依赖项正确。
4. 如果以上步骤都没有解决问题,可以尝试查看POI库的文档或官方网站,寻找关于getCellType()方法的变更或替代方法。
希望以上信息对你有帮助!如果还有其他问题,请随时提问。